Introduction The colour formed when stainless steel is heated, either in a furnace application or in the heat affected zone of welds, is dependent on several factors that are related to the oxidation resistance of the steel. The heat tint or temper colour formed is caused by the progressive thickening of the surface oxide layer and so, as temperature is increased, the colours change.   Oxidation resistance of stainless steels However, there are several factors that affect the degree of colour change and so there is no a single table of colour and temperature that represents all cases. The colours formed can only be used as an indication of the temperature to which the steel has been heated. Factors affecting the heat tint colours formed Steel composition The chromium content is the most important single factor affecting oxidation resistance. ------------------------------------- Interpretation:  I‑89‑14 Subject:         Section I (1986 Edition, 1987 Addenda), PW‑11,                  NDE Prior to PWHT Date Issued:     December 15, 1988 File:            BC88‑393   Question: Does PW‑11 require that NDE be performed on welds after they have been subjected to the postweld heat treatment required by PW‑39?   Reply: No, unless the conditions described in PW‑11.2.2 exist. ---------------------------------------------- Interpretation:  VIII-1-98-09 Subject:         Section VIII, Division 1 (1995 Edition, 1996 Addenda); NDE                 ...

Q: What are equivalents for standard Q 235 B (and Q 235 A) for U-channels? (asked by: boris.vielhaber@vait.com) A: DIN Nr. = 2393 T.2, 2394 T.2, EN 10025 W. Nr. DIN 17007 = 1.0038 Design DIN 17006 = RSt 37-2, S235JRG2 (Fe 360 B) Q: What is St DIN 2391 BK material? (asked by: dmcandrews@automaticstamp.com) A: Precision steel tubes, cold-finished/hard.
